| ENVIRONMENTAL DREDGING |
|
Infrastructure Alternatives utilizes hydraulic dredges fitted with sophisticated positioning equipment in the execution of environmental dredging projects. When governed by these electronic control devices, hydraulic dredges are particularly accurate in the minimization of over-dredge and sediment dispersion. Hydraulic dredging of contaminated marine sediments can also be seamlessly integrated with geotextile tube dewatering in one flow-through process. Infrastructure Alternatives has pioneered this practice which has demonstrated:
-
Effective removal of contamination from bodies of water
-
Support for high dredge production rates
-
Successful capture of contaminated sediment, separating entrained water which can be treated as needed and discharged back into the water body
-
Reduced sediment disposal costs

| NAVIGATIONAL DREDGING |
|
Infrastructure Alternatives is equipped to perform mechanical or hydraulic dredging, or any combination thereof, in the execution of a navigational or maintenance dredging project. Selection of a dredging method is based on both economical and environmental considerations.
We approach navigational dredging with sensitivity to the local community. Disruption of use is kept to a minimum. Lighted buoys and markers are used to clearly identify submerged pipelines and signage is used to inform the public of dredging activities. Silt curtains are used to keep turbidity down. Operations are as clean, neat and quiet as possible.
Navigational dredging can be paired with sediment dewatering services for beneficial use and the minimization of disposal costs.
